Living Positively with IBS (Irritable Bowel Syndrome) IBS is a common chronic digestive disorder that affects more than 5 million Canadians. It can be painful, debilitating and frustrating. IBS involves problems with motility (how we move contents through our intestines) and sensitivity (how the brain interprets sensations in the bowel). Understanding and Harnessing the Power of Probiotics There is much buzz out there about probiotics these days. These friendly bacteria can be used to prevent and treat disease -- particularly in our gut. Probiotics stimulate the immune system and displace harmful bacteria that might otherwise cause disease. Specific digestive benefits of probiotics can include: reducing the severity and duration of diarrhea, treating constipation, improving the symptoms of, preventing ulcerative colitis from relapsing, counteracting lactose intolerance and more.Watch WebSeminar
